THE LONDON BOROUGH OF BROMLEY

Public Notice - The Bromley (Waiting And Loading Restriction) Order 2003 (Amendment No.***) Order 202* - (Albany Road, Alexander Road, Green Lane, Park Road And Queens Road, Chislehurst) - T843

N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Council of The London Borough of Bromley proposes to make the above-mentioned Order under Sections 6 and 124 and Part IV of Schedule 9 to the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984 (as amended) and all other enabling powers.

The general effect of the above-mentioned Order would be to amend the Bromley (Waiting and Loading Restrictions) Order 2003, to update the description of the waiting restrictions as set out in the schedules to this Notice, in Albany Road, Alexander Road, Green Lane, Park Road and Queens Road. This paper-based amendment will bring official records in line with already exists on-street, requiring no physical changes on-site.

Details of prohibitions and exemptions for certain vehicles and persons are contained in the original Order.

Copies of the proposed Order, plans and the Council's statement of reasons for proposing to make the Order can be inspected during normal office hours Monday to Friday at: Bromley Council, Churchill Court, 2 Westmoreland Road, Bromley, BR1 1AS.

Any person wishing to object to the proposed Order should send a statement in writing of their objection and the grounds thereof to The Assistant Director Of Traffic and Parking, Bromley Council, Churchill Court, 2 Westmoreland Road, Bromley, BR1 1AS, or by email: TrafficManagementOrders@bromley.gov.uk, quoting reference: - ADE(TP)/MW/SF/T843 no later than 12th August 2026.

Persons objecting to the proposed Order should be aware that under the provisions of the Local Government (Access to Information) Act 1985, any comments received in response to this Notice may be open to public inspection.
